UNITED STATES—Over 50 people were killed, and more than 200 people were injured during a mass shooting in Las Vegas, Nevada on Sunday, October 1. Amongst those killed, were two off-duty police officers who have not yet been identified. The shooting transpired from a hotel room inside the Mandalay Bay hotel near the Las Vegas Strip.

The suspect has been identified as Stephen Paddock, 64, who shot multiple rounds of gunfire from a window inside his room looking down on the Route 91 Harvest Fest, a country music festival that transpired at 10:08 p.m. There were more than 20,000 people at the event when the shooting started.

Sheriff Joe Lombardo of the Las Vegas Metropolitan Police Department spoke to the media indicating that officers located Paddock’s room and found him deceased. They were able to locate his room because the countless gunfire set off the smoke alarm inside his room on the 32nd floor. Police found over 8 weapons inside the suspect’s room, utilized 2 platforms and cameras during the shooting.

Lombardo spoke on Monday, October 2 during a press conference where he revealed that over 400 people were injured. “The only criminal background for [Paddock] was a citation from several years ago,” stated Lombardo.

Fox News spoke to Russell Bleck, a victim who was inside a tent at the time when the shooting transpired. Bleck captured video of the incident as it transpired, noting that the suspect shot rapidly with seven second intervals in between re-loading weapons to continue firing upon the patrons. The shooting is the deadliest in the United States history. Authorities have executed a search warrant at Paddock’s home in Mesquite, Nevada, where no previous criminal background was established. A motive for the shooting has yet to be disclosed to the public.

According to reports, police were searching for Marilou Danley who was considered a person of interest in the incident, but is no longer involved in the shooting. Danley was believed to be a companion with Paddock, who police suspected may have been involved in the incident.

Reports indicate that over 400 people were transported to local hospitals after the shooting that transpired on the Las Vegas strip.

Authorities revealed that Paddock had been staying inside his Mandalay Bay hotel room since September 28. Police do not suspect the incident to be a result of terrorism and that the shooter acted alone during the incident.
